Psychoeducational evaluations can be used for a variety of reasons.
The most common use is to determine if a child has special needs which might need to be accommodated in the public school setting. But there are a few others.

- Some people are interested in their cognitive abilities.
- People want to know if there is something that isn't working correctly.
- Sometimes people want to determine if they can qualify for accommodations on national testing such as the ACT, SAT, GMAT, GRE, LSAT, etc.
- They might be eligible for exclusions from certain classes in college, such as a foreign language exemption.
- Another common reason is for accommodations in their college courses, such as extended time or a copy of notes ahead of time.
